Transaction 23fd9afdaba854af875533eaeff0fab2165ea674c6c394d4bcd2553d56ac740a
1 Input
1 Output
-
23fd9afdaba854af875533eaeff0fab2165ea674c6c394d4bcd2553d56ac740a:0
- value
- 504551
- script pubkey
- OP_0 OP_PUSHBYTES_20 3beac3ffb16c7a78098e8168bb6a32d5a88f9c56
- address
- bc1q804v8la3d3a8szvws95tk63j6k5gl8zk6r20el